our team as we help shape a brighter way forward. Instrumentation
Technician - JLL What this job involves: The Instrumentation
Technician is responsible for performing service activities
relating to the calibration, maintenance and repairs of
instrumentation calibration instruments and equipment. A

challenges. What your day-to-day will look like: Provide
calibration, troubleshooting, and repair of analytical instruments
used in industrial process equipment. Enter calibration data and
service information into the CMMS. Respond to trouble calls and
perform diagnostics and repairs. Escort vendors in need of lab
access to perform assigned calibration and maintenance work. Ensure
vendor provides complete maintenance documentation upon work
completion. Review and process external vendor calibration, PM and
repair documentation per established procedures. Assist with
identification and purchase of spare parts. Prepare and organize
technical documentation and operational procedures. Write
calibration and preventive maintenance Standard Operating
Procedures or Work Instructions. Collect and organize technical
data from equipment manufacturers, equipment users, and engineering
personnel. Mentor other instrument and instrumentation technicians.
Must know the operating principles and be proficient with the
operational techniques of instrumentation analytical instruments.
General knowledge of GxP. Must be able to work with minimal
supervision. Obtain vendor quotes and submit work authorizations.
Collaborate with Lab Users to ensure equipment availability and
minimal interruption to operations. Work overtime or temporarily
modify shift schedule to support Life Sciences R&D Operations
